Hi, I'm travelling so using internet cafes. Using a memory stick I put my SD card into PC and the folder (DCIM) which stores all my photos had become a screen saver. Later, I did this (to try to get into the folder) :

Click "Start" and type "cmd" into the search box. Press "Enter" and wait for the Command Prompt to appear.

Type "chkdsk x: /f," but replace "x" with your SD card's drive letter.

Now the SD card doesn't show up when I insert it into the PC using the memory stick. I know the memory stick is working because I can still see files that were on it before, but no SD card.

Have tried on a few computers and nothing. Also, when I put the card into my Canon camera it says 'card cannot create folder'.

This is the second memory card that this has happened to, bought the second one as a replacement when it happened the first time a month ago.

There are a lot of important videos and photos on both cards. What can I do?/what is causing this to happen?

1. Try to use non-Windows computers having slightly different device protocols.
2. Try to copy or repair the card using physical-level utilities, e.g. GParted (do it accurately!).
3. Save backups as frequently as you can as SDs, unlike CFs, have an annoying tendency to degrade spontaneously.
